According to EPA SDWIS, Sandy Hook, Kentucky is served by 1 community water system covering about 3,528 people. PlainEnviro's health-based extract shows zero health-based violation records for those systems. Counts are historical EPA registry rows, not a current compliance or drinkability score.
Drinking water in Sandy Hook, Kentucky is delivered through 1 EPA-regulated community water system serving an estimated 3,528 people. Each system is tracked in the EPA Safe Drinking Water Information System (SDWIS) under the Safe Drinking Water Act, which requires testing for regulated contaminants, consumer notification of violations, and publication of an annual Consumer Confidence Report.
PlainEnviro's health-based SDWIS extract shows 0 violation records across the 1 active community system shown here. Monitoring and reporting records are not present in the extract. No contaminant code appears in the health-based records.
A past EPA health-based registry row does not describe water delivered today or current compliance status; utilities notify customers and remediate under state primacy oversight when required. For current water-quality status and treatment practices, review your local utility's most recent Consumer Confidence Report or contact the Kentucky drinking water program.
